i’m on this drug as an anti-depressant. causes vivid dreams for me, or did when i first started it. i think the sedative effect, which quickly fades, is the result of anti-histamine action. this does not increase with dose or something, and people often say lower doses are more sedating. definitely zero recreational potential. i’ve heard of people taking huge doses to get a deleriant effect — like too much benadryl— but that’s toxic, dysphoric, and desperate.

They're exactly like Quetiapine and Olanzepine. Knock-out type sedative, but not in a nice way like Zopiclone or benzo's. More of an unpleasant lethargy. If you're an underweight insomniac I'm sure they're great. Basically they'll make you binge on simple carbohydrates and then sleep for 16 hours. You'll feel really worn out well into the next day too.
No recreational value. Nothing enjoyable about them. Like Quetiapine, smaller doses are much better for sleep. 15mg will knock you out more than 45mg.
